你查询的IP:[116.4.20.88]  地理位置:中国–广东–东莞

最新查询218.192.45.97 121.192.106.218 124.29.155.147 117.57.233.181 60.255.187.232 121.248.186.35 120.30.47.183 118.24.86.94 221.196.159.165 116.4.20.88 202.127.40.212 123.196.166.96 124.200.84.146 202.91.224.218 124.29.125.91 119.59.128.116 119.57.134.176 218.195.108.105 221.198.176.87 116.58.208.125 120.94.247.21 121.32.251.76 117.106.78.131 123.177.121.130 116.248.92.205 202.38.158.181 124.20.169.199 203.95.96.66 120.137.75.88 221.224.159.86 119.28.23.112